Batman Bot

A twitter bot made in node js :heart: . The bot continuosly likes and favorites random recent tweets featuring #Batman every 60 minutes.
It uses Heroku for server side deployment.
Can be installed by using npm package manager or by cloning this repo

npm install batmanbot
or
git clone https://github.com/vedipen/BatmanBot.git

  • To make the bot work, one needs to insert twitter account's API keys in
    config.js.
  • To change search query, one needs to change the list in bot.js according to his/her liking.

To run -
npm start
